一、VPS端口查看方法总结
卡尔云官网
www.kaeryun.com
在虚拟服务器(VPS)管理中,端口查看是基本操作之一,以下是一些常用工具及其使用方法:
使用nslookup查看端口状态
nslookup
是一个强大的网络工具,可快速获取服务器的端口信息。
步骤:
- 打开终端。
- 输入以下命令:
nslookup <目标服务器IP>
- 等待工具完成,查看输出结果。
示例:
假设目标服务器IP为 168.1.100
,执行命令:
nslookup 192.168.1.100
输出结果中会显示各个端口的状态,包括是否被占用。
使用tracert查看端口状态
tracert
可以帮助确认端口是否可达。
步骤:
- 打开终端。
- 输入以下命令:
tracert <目标服务器IP>
- 等待工具完成,查看输出结果。
示例: 执行命令:
tracert 192.168.1.100
如果输出中显示端口不可达,说明该端口被占用。
使用ns3进行深入分析
ns3
是一个功能强大的网络模拟工具,适合深入分析网络状态。
步骤:
- 下载并安装
ns3
。 - 打开终端,输入以下命令:
ns3
- 在ns3环境中配置目标服务器,运行分析。
示例:
配置目标服务器IP 168.1.100
,运行分析:
ns3 ns3> config machine ip 192.168.1.100 ns3> ns3:1> ns3> run analysis
分析结果会显示服务器的端口使用情况。
使用nslookup查看端口分配
nslookup
还可以显示端口分配情况。
步骤:
- 打开终端。
- 输入命令:
nslookup <目标服务器IP>
- 分析输出结果。
示例: 执行命令:
nslookup 192.168.1.100
输出中会显示所有已绑定的端口及其用途。
使用ns3监控端口状态
在ns3环境中,可以设置端口监控功能。
步骤:
- 打开终端,输入以下命令:
ns3
- 配置目标服务器:
ns3> config machine ip 192.168.1.100
- 设置端口监控:
ns3> ns3:1> ns3> set interface mon /dev/null ns3> ns3:1> ns3> set interface eth0 rate 1000000 ns3> ns3:1> ns3> set interface eth0 bind 192.168.1.100:22 ns3> ns3:1> ns3> run
使用tracert查看端口可达性
tracert
是另一个简单工具,可检查端口是否可达。
步骤:
- 打开终端。
- 输入命令:
tracert <目标服务器IP>
- 分析输出结果。
示例: 执行命令:
tracert 192.168.1.100
如果输出中显示端口可达,说明该端口未被占用。
常见问题解答
-
为什么nslookup显示端口占用?
答:因为目标服务器的该端口被其他应用程序占用,可能用于HTTP、HTTPS、SSH等服务。
-
如何查看所有端口?
- 答:使用
nslookup
或ns3
工具,它们会显示所有已绑定的端口及其用途。
- 答:使用
-
如何检查特定端口是否可达?
- 答:使用
tracert
或nslookup
工具,查看目标端口的状态。
- 答:使用
-
如何避免端口被占用?
答:在安装VPS前,使用工具检查所有端口状态,确保未冲突。
端口查看是VPS管理的基础技能,使用nslookup
、tracert
、ns3
等工具可快速定位问题,正确使用这些工具,可帮助 you 避免服务中断,提升系统安全性。
卡尔云官网
www.kaeryun.com